Simple Does Not Mean Easy
A completed project can feel so natural that it is difficult to imagine it any other way. Rooms connect without awkward transitions, materials relate quietly to one another, and storage appears where it is needed without dominating the space. Structure, lighting, and mechanical systems perform their work without competing for attention.
The result may look simple, but that simplicity is rarely the product of an easy process. Complexity often appears by itself as ideas, requirements, systems, preferences, and constraints accumulate. Simplicity must be created deliberately. It requires the project team to understand what matters most, coordinate what must remain, and remove what does not contribute enough value.
At the beginning of design, possibilities are exciting. Owners encounter materials, features, technologies, layouts, and examples that may all seem worth considering. Each participant also brings legitimate requirements. The engineer identifies structural needs, the builder considers constructability, trade professionals address system performance, codes establish minimum standards, and the owner introduces functional goals and aesthetic preferences.
None of these contributions is necessarily excessive on its own. Complexity develops as they accumulate without a clear hierarchy. Another material is added to create interest, another ceiling change distinguishes one area from another, and another feature addresses a narrow concern. Each decision may be defensible, yet together they can make the building feel unresolved.
Simplicity therefore requires more than limiting the number of features. It requires organizing the entire project around a coherent purpose.
Early design ideas often solve one problem while creating several others. Moving a wall may improve one room but complicate circulation in another. Adding an island may provide work surface while narrowing important walkways. Raising a ceiling may create volume while introducing structural, mechanical, and lighting conflicts.
The first idea is valuable because it begins the exploration, but it should not be protected merely because it arrived first. Simpler solutions often emerge after the team has studied the problem from several directions. An addition may become unnecessary when existing space is reorganized. Several architectural gestures may be replaced by one stronger move. A complicated structural response may be avoided through a modest layout adjustment.
The eventual solution may appear obvious, but it became obvious only after less effective alternatives were understood.

When every goal receives equal weight, the design attempts to solve everything simultaneously. When priorities are clear, the team can determine which ideas strengthen the project and which merely add activity. A homeowner may value connection and natural light more than additional square footage. A business may prioritize flexibility and communication over the maximum number of enclosed offices.
These priorities give the design permission to reject solutions that do not serve its central purpose. Without that clarity, editing feels like loss. With it, editing becomes a way of protecting what matters.
Design is often described as the process of creating ideas, but much of its most important work involves refining and removing them. A material may be beautiful but unnecessary. A feature may be useful but located where it weakens circulation. A detail may attract attention while distracting from the larger composition. An idea may solve a minor problem while consuming resources needed for a more important one.
Removing these elements can be difficult because time and enthusiasm have already been invested in them. The team must evaluate each idea according to what it contributes, not according to how much effort has already been spent developing it. Good editing does not make a project empty or generic. It allows the strongest ideas to become more visible.
A simple finished result does not mean the building lacks technical complexity. A clean ceiling may conceal coordinated structure, ductwork, wiring, insulation, lighting, and fire protection. A minimal transition between materials may require precise substrate preparation and careful sequencing. A wide opening may appear effortless only after engineering, temporary support, beam installation, utility relocation, and detailed finish work.
The complexity has not disappeared. It has been resolved and organized.
This distinction matters because visual simplicity should not be achieved by ignoring technical requirements. It should result from integrating those requirements so thoroughly that they support the design without overwhelming it.
The simpler a detail appears, the less room it may leave for inconsistency. Ornament and additional trim can sometimes conceal small variations, while a minimal detail exposes alignment, proportion, material transitions, and workmanship. When elements are intended to meet cleanly, dimensions and installation sequences must be understood before construction reaches that point.
Simple designs therefore require careful documentation and communication. Designers, builders, and trade professionals must agree on what each detail is intended to accomplish and how every part contributes to it. The absence of visible complexity places greater responsibility on planning and execution.
Complexity also has financial consequences. Every additional material may require procurement, delivery, preparation, installation, transitions, and future maintenance. Every change in plane or ceiling height may affect framing, drywall, trim, lighting, and mechanical coordination. Every unique detail requires someone to understand and build it.

The least expensive option is not always the simplest, and a simple appearance may require considerable craftsmanship. The economic value comes from making complexity purposeful rather than allowing it to accumulate without providing enough benefit.
A clear design direction also makes later decisions easier. When the project has an established material palette, new selections can be evaluated according to whether they belong within it. When the layout is organized around a few important relationships, proposed changes can be assessed by how they strengthen or weaken those relationships.
The project no longer needs to reconsider its identity with every decision. This consistency becomes especially valuable during construction, when time is limited and unexpected questions may arise. A clear set of priorities gives the team a reliable basis for responding without introducing ideas that pull the project in another direction.
The best simplicity does not call attention to how hard the team worked to achieve it. The owner experiences a room that supports daily life, materials that feel appropriate, and details that belong together. The underlying decisions and coordination remain largely invisible.
This is one reason simple projects can be underestimated. People see the resolved result rather than the alternatives that were studied, the conflicts that were coordinated, or the features that were deliberately removed. What looks effortless is often the product of considerable discipline.
A Final Thought
Complexity is easy to add because every project contains more possibilities than it needs. Simplicity is harder because it requires understanding, prioritizing, coordinating, and editing those possibilities until the essential ideas remain.
A simple project is not one in which little thought occurred. It is one in which the thinking became clear enough that the finished building no longer needs to explain itself. The result feels natural because the complexity was resolved before construction made it permanent.
